Reusing the user's responses as future bot responses is a concept that has
come up a number of times. The mailing list archives will contain a number
of references.

However, the core of the debate mostly surrounds around the idea whether it
is a good idea to have regular users update or add to your knowledgebase.
Those who have experimented will have mixed experiences. Of course, there
will be some real gems of answers added but it will mostly be of a different
tone then what has been written already and often downright insulting.

If you go this route then thread carefully.

Im using python for my bots that use AIML and I was wondering about
something. I usually keep logs of what my bot says and its responses from
other people. Now what Im thinking is having another python script that goes
through these responses and generate or update its current AIML markups
based on reversing the roles of responses and the statements by and from the
responder (does this make sense?)
For example if someone asked if today is sunday and the bot's response is
that it doesnt know and the responder tells it to ignore it. The script will
update the AIML so that if someone tells the bot that they dont know what
day it is today, the bot will tell them to ignore it.
 
Has this been done before? Im just thinking in a very general manner here,
im sure there are alot of ways in which this can be improved.
Any comments or thoughts or obstacles with this aside from the obvious
overfitting/overspecialized AIML; but I intend to counter this with more
general chats.
